    Abstract: Systems and methods for detecting vulnerability of a server are provided. One system includes: a check server for collecting response information with respect to at least one predetermined command from one or more service servers that provide service, and thus may be attacked from outside, and detecting and analyzing vulnerabilities of the service servers based on the collected response information; an administration terminal for displaying the results of detecting and analyzing the vulnerabilities of the service servers; and a database for storing and managing pattern information concerning the detected vulnerabilities. One method includes identifying a server that may be attacked by port scanning, receiving response information with respect to at least one predetermined command from the identified server, detecting and analyzing vulnerability of the server based on the response information, and reporting the result of the detection to an administration terminal.

    Abstract: An image pickup device includes a sensor substrate having image sensors arranged in its image pickup region in the form of a matrix. An interlayer insulating film layer is formed below a bottom of the sensor substrate. The interlayer insulating film layer includes wiring layers to construct an electric circuit. The wiring layer is electrically connected with the image sensors. A support substrate is attached on a bottom of the interlayer insulating film layer. The support substrate has contact electrodes formed in via holes. A lens layer is formed over the top surface of the sensor substrate to be opposite to the interlayer insulating film layer. A light-transmitting member is formed over the lens layer.

    Abstract: A varifocal optical device is provided. The varifocal optical device includes an optical lens, an actuator unit connected with the optical lens and having two areas that are bending-deformed in opposite directions to each other when a voltage is applied thereto, and a supporting unit to support the actuator unit, so that a focus of the optical lens is varied by the bending deformation when the voltage is applied to the actuator unit. Thereby, a driving displacement of the varifocal optical lens can be maximized.

    Abstract: Disclosed is an optical fiber block having holding sub-blocks. The optical fiber block comprises: an optical fiber arrangement section having a V-groove array including a plurality of V-grooves; a stress-relieving recess section extending from the optical fiber arrangement section, the stress-relieving recess section having a flat surface on which a ribbon optical fiber is fixed, the flat surface being formed to be substantially lower than the lower ends of the V-grooves by etching; and at least one holding sub-block formed on a rear portion of the side edge of the flat surface of the stress-relieving recess section, so as to prevent the ribbon optical fiber placed on the flat surface from escaping out of the flat surface and guide the flow of epoxy resin injected toward the ribbon optical fiber.
